Quasi-Static Design Approach For Low Q Factor Electrically Small Antennas

Abstract:
Methods and apparatuses are described that enable the design of electrically small antennas in terms of their quality factor (Q) performance or other antenna parameter. A desired charge distribution is defined and thereafter the shape of the antenna is generated, based on the corresponding solution of a quasi-static field approximation. A degree of freedom in the shaping of the antenna is incorporated into the quasi-static field approximation, via a dimensional variable. This expression has a solution set containing the minimum Q factor. By selection of an appropriate value of the dimensional variable, antennas with minimum or otherwise tailored Q values can be quickly designed.

Layered Superconductor Device And Method

Abstract:
A layered superconductor device includes multiple layers of a single crystal superconducting material having intermittent layers of superconducting material dispersed in a pattern with a second material such that each layer of the multiple layers a single crystal superconducting material are interconnected via superconducting material, allowing for a continuous current path, and a thickness of the superconducting material never exceeds a first predetermined thickness.
